Sudden Death.

* Dttnedin, March 23, • A painfully sudden death occurred ' in the Exhibition buildings. David M. Logan, a well known Customs i officer, and Lieutenant, of the Naval ■ Artillery, took a violin to be shown in the Exhibition court, and, meeting a ""- friend who asked about his health, t said he felt "as right as the mail." ■ But, on entering the " Early History ■ ' Court," he sat down, gave three ' gasps, and expired. He was a man •'. with a family, and his wife is on her way to town to take part in the festivities.
